| There are commonly three types of irrigation systems used. |
- Microsprinklers
for herbaceous borders, flowerbeds, vegetable gardens, fruit trees and garden houses.
- Dripper Systems
for tubs, hanging baskets, pots and grow bags.
- Pop-up sprinklers
For lawns, occassional borders and vegetable gardens

- Water Saving
The Micro Sprinkler emitter scientifically controls the spray making optimum use of available water over a greater area. The evaporation factor is lowered because;
- The wetted area is carefully confined
- The emitter is close to the ground and the relatively large droplets formed are not easily blown away
- Irrigation should take place in the evening, allowing deep penetration
- Better Growth and Yield
The system allows careful selection of the emitter that best suits the crop type. A selection of nozzles and spreaders/swivels enable precise watering of the targeted area. Plants get the right amount of water in the right place encouraging better growth and less disease. Spray can cover large area contributing to a healthier and wider root distribution and better anchorage.
- Energy Saving
The Micro Sprinkler system is a very low-pressure system for gardeners. Mains water pressure should be perfect and usually no pump is required for nurseries and growers water propelled solely by gravity is often sufficient. If pumping is required usually low pressure and low volume pumps are necessary.

 The Octadripper is a variable flow dripper that enables each specific container to be irrigated for optimum growth. They are used in the same way as the Micro Sprinkler system but enable more precise and localised watering of individual plants. The flow rate is variable from 0 to 40 liters per hour. - Easy to install and use.
- Low-pressure system.
- The dripper is connected to the mainline polypipe with 4mm leader tube.
- Plan the layout of the polypipe using a tap connector, tees and elbows
- At a point nearest each container, pierce the polypipe with the hole punch. cut the leader tube to length required and insert the Octadripper in one end and the adaptor in the other end. Push the other end of the adaptor into the hole in the polypipe
- Adjust the flow to suit the container.

 Pop-Up sprinklers are principally designed for the irrigation of lawns. They are fitted just below ground level so as not to interfere with mowing or grass games. These sprinklers rely soley on water pressure for their operation and only lift above ground level whilst irrigating. |

| Different types of Pop-Up sprinklers are available if required, which range from; |
- Variety of models available with 0 to 360 degree adjustable arcs
- Suitable for areas ranging from hebaceuous beds to large lawns
- Easily installed underground, they are vandal resistant and unobtrusive
- Pop-Up sprinklers must be overlapped by 50% of their wetted area for even watering
- For optimum results we recommend using a minimum pipe size of 25mm MDPE
